Multi-Grammy-nominated pianist Marta Aznavoorian has built an impressive international career as a soloist, chamber musician, and educator, marked by bold interpretations and a deep connection to both classical and contemporary works. A Chicago native who made her debut with the Chicago Symphony Orchestra at 13 under the invitation of Sir Georg Solti, she has performed with orchestras around the world and collaborated with leading conductors and composers of our time. As a founding member of the Lincoln Trio, she has toured extensively and recorded widely, with projects that spotlight both established and underrepresented voices. Dedicated to teaching and mentorship, she serves on the faculties of DePaul University and the Music Institute of Chicago, and her nonprofit, Keynote Productions, supports music education for students from underserved communities. Aznavoorian records for Cedille, Warner Classics, Naxos, and other labels and is a Steinway Artist.
